Course Description

The world is filled with developers who know multiple web programming languages but haven't applied them anywhere. Just knowing the syntax does not matter.

What matters is TO APPLY that knowledge to build something. Easy or tough doesn't matter, you should just make something out of your knowledge.

"Web Application Development - Learn by Building 3 Web Apps" will make you LEARN HTML5 and jQuery and also APPLY them to make 3 amazing Web Applications! All this in just 90 Minutes! So what are you waiting for?

This course will teach you the most frequently used functions and techniques of HTML5 and jQueryand by the end of the course you will be having your own :

1. Animated keyboard controllable snake game.

2. A magnifier application which is used in major E-commerce stores like Ebay and Amazon.

3. An interactive web form with progress bar.

The course includes :

  1. Explanatory in-depth Videos.
  2. Presentations.
  3. Source code files of all the programs discussed and projects made.
  4. Supplementary Material for better understanding
  5. Quizzes at the end of section to revise and know how much you have learnt.
  6. Complete support material for all technical problems

Course Structure :

The course is divided into 7 sections given below:

  1. Course Summary and Supplementary Material
  2. New Features of HTML5
  3. jQuery Fundamentals
  4. Application 1: Making a web form with progress bar
  5. Application 2: Making the Magnifier Application
  6. Application 3: Making the Snake Game
  7. Bonus Lectures

Why take this Course :

After completing this course you will be able to

  1. Master most used functions of HTML 5 and j-Query.
  2. Make your own 2-D games.
  3. Make interactive websites with increased functionality.
  4. Design better User Interfaces
  5. Increase your grasping of web development technologies.

What are the pre-requisites / requirements?

  • Basic knowledge of HTML, CSS will be helpful (but not necessary)
  • Google Chrome (or any other modern web browser)
  • Sublime Text Editor (http://www.sublimetext.com) or any other text editor.

What am I going to get from this course?

  • Over 29 lectures and 1.5 hours of content!
  • Learn Basic and Advanced Level jQuery
  • Learn the new concepts introduced by HTML5
  • Make a snake game from jQuery and HTML5
  • Make a Magnifier Application for E-commerce websites
  • Make an Interactive Web form with Progress bar

What is the target audience?

  • School or College students.
  • Web Developers
  • Freelancers
  • User Interface Designers
  • Entrepreneurs
  • Anyone who wants to learn.

Akshay Nagpal

Akshay Nagpal is a Computer Engineer having a keen interest in web development, Search Engine Optimization, Blogging and Wordpress. He's been actively developing projects in C, C++, Java, HTML5, CSS3,Javascript ,Jquery, PHP & MySQL since 2010. He loves open source projects and you can view his Github profile He works as a professional Web Designer for college websites and events. He also teaches and encourages people to start web development. You can follow him on twitter to know more!

Course curriculum

  • 1

    Course Summary and Supplementary Material

    • Why should you take this course?

    • Instructions for Students and Frequently Asked Questions

    • Software Requirements for the Course

  • 2

    New Features of HTML5

    • Introduction to HTML5

    • DOCTYPE

    • Canvas Element

    • Datalist Element

    • Using HTML5 Input Types to Enhance the Mobile Browsing Experience

    • Live Coding: Range Input Type

    • HTML5 Quiz!

  • 3

    jQuery Fundamentals

    • Getting Started with jQuery

    • Selectors and Events in jQuery

    • Effect 1: Show / Hide

    • Effect 2: Fading

    • Effect 3: Sliding

    • Basics of Animation

    • jQuery Quiz

  • 4

    Application 1: Making a web form with progress bar

    • Designing the Form using HTML5

    • Linking the Progress Bar with User Input using jQuery

    • Progress Form Source Code

  • 5

    Application 2: Making the Magnifier Application

    • Initialising the Image and Magnifier

    • Toggle Visibility of the Magnifier

    • Making the Magnifier move with Cursor

    • Magnifier Source Code

  • 6

    Application 3: Making the Snake Game

    • About the Snake Game

    • Making the Snake and Game Area

    • Designing Game Rules

    • Making the Snake Keyboard Controllable

    • Snake Source Code

    • You did it!

  • 7

    Bonus Content

    • Some More features of HTML5